After a difficult year, Lily Allen is enjoying a relaxing getaway. This comes as she and her ex-husband, David Harbour, have officially put their Brooklyn home up for sale. They initially listed the beautifully renovated property for almost $8 million in late 2025, but have since lowered the price to $7.3 million as they work to divide their belongings.

The singer is enjoying a particularly joyful period in her life as her career is taking off. 2026 promises to be a hugely successful year, mainly because her fifth album, West End Girl, has become a massive hit. Many fans think the album was influenced by her recent divorce, and it has already been streamed over 150 million times, leading to multiple nominations for the 2026 BRIT Awards.

Lily Allen is hitting the road again! She’s launching her first big tour in seven years, called the “West End Girl Tour,” starting in the UK this March. The tour begins in Glasgow and will finish with several shows at the London Palladium. Because tickets are selling so quickly, she’s also added a series of larger arena concerts in June and July, including three nights at London’s O2 Arena.
